The Mini-Circuits BPJC-542R+ is an LTCC (Low Temperature Co-fired Ceramic) bandpass filter optimized for high band Wi-Fi applications. It features a passband spanning from 4900 to 5900 MHz, making it suitable for signal cleaning in these frequency ranges.
This filter provides a typical insertion loss of 1.0 dB. It offers significant out-of-band suppression with a minimum of 40 dB rejection in the lower stopband and 34 dB in the upper stopband. The device is designed to handle up to 1W of RF input power and operates reliably across a wide temperature range of -55 to +100°C.
Constructed using LTCC technology, the BPJC-542R+ is fabricated in a compact ceramic monolith measuring 0.08 x 0.05 x 0.02 inches, identified by case style JC0603C-1. This small footprint is ideal for space-constrained circuit board layouts. The filter has a nominal impedance of 50 Ohms and features wraparound terminations for excellent solderability and easy visual inspection, making it suitable for volume production.
